Output 34a7d95f2a32bf330d9f8d0eec77d8dc17bacb2f3021a82f2ae204414c7ca8c5:6

value
857646968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5fdf1651a263f729e4d6bf04efc7fc7f70b9628 OP_EQUAL
address
3JHJSXin9Puz6xnhcsUG8rCYd3AHidcbD1
transaction
34a7d95f2a32bf330d9f8d0eec77d8dc17bacb2f3021a82f2ae204414c7ca8c5
confirmations
282134
spent
true